The Insomniac's Guide to a Good Night's Sleep

Tagged:  •    •    •  

Sleep: that magical time between evening and morning when the body relaxes and rejuvenates. Unfortunately, for nearly 40% of Americans, this time is usually filled with tossing, turning, and frequent waking. These are textbook symptoms of insomnia, the most common sleep disorder in the United States.
